Kemaman resident Muhammad Urabil Alias dresses as a ghost to keep people, especially children, at home during the movement control order.

It is not a genuine spirit but local man Muhammad Urabil Alias, who has taken to dressing up in a white robe and mask and going on regular night-time patrols. Like many countries seeking to fight the spread of the virus, Malaysia has ordered people to stay at home, and closed schools and non-essential businesses.

“I am watching the news and I see more people are dead, so I decided to scare people,” the 38-year-old told AFP.Abdillah said whenever the town’s youngsters see him on patrol, they “run like crazy back to their homes. Now before they go out, they have to check whether the ghost is around or not”.
